Steve Albert Hulka 1915 - 1998

Steve Albert Hulka of Reno, Washoe County, NV was born on December 1, 1915, and died at age 83 years old on December 3, 1998. Steve Hulka was buried at Northern Nevada Veterans Memorial Cemetery Section 2A Site 119 14 Veterans Way, in Fernley.

In 1915, in the year that Steve Albert Hulka was born, in May, the RMS Lusitania was sunk by a German torpedo. The Lusitania was a British passenger ship that was sailing from New York to Liverpool England. She sank in 18 minutes - 1,198 died and 761 survived. While travelers were the main casualty - and commodity - the Lusitania did carry wartime weapons. "Remember the Lusitania" became the rallying cry of World War 1.

In 1922, Steve was just 7 years old when on June 22, coal miners in Herrin Illinois, were on strike (coal miners had been on strike nationally since April 1). The striking miners were outraged at the strikebreakers (scabs) that the company had brought in and laid siege to the mine. Three union workers were killed when gunfire was exchanged. The next day, union miners killed 23 strikebreakers and mine guards. No one, on either side, ever faced jail time.
